Investment Thesis
Sterling & Wilson Renewable Energy Ltd (SWREL) is a global leader in solar EPC (Engineering, Procurement, and Construction) services, with significant operations across India and globally. Despite weak financial performance, including a negative ROE and high valuation multiples, SWREL is backed by a robust order pipeline, strong industry tailwinds, and operational improvements. These factors position it as a speculative growth investment in the renewable energy sector.
Future Growth Drivers
Strong Order Book
- Unexecuted order value of ₹10,167 Cr as of December 2024
- 26% increase compared to March 2024
- Recent domestic orders:
- BOS package (625 MW DC) in Gujarat
- BOS project (396 MW DC) in Rajasthan

Risks and Considerations
Financial Risks
- Negative ROE of -56.7%
- Low ROCE at 3.77%
- High receivables (₹2,422 Cr)
- Potential liquidity challenges
Operational Risks
- Legacy international project impacts
- Seasonal and cyclical order inflows
- Dependence on government policies
- Foreign exchange fluctuation risks
